Why Is My Electric Oven Turning On But Not Heating Up?

The Oven is Not Heating An oven that won’t heat is usually the result of a faulty igniter (for a gas oven) or heating element (for an electric oven). You may be able to replace the heating element or igniter yourself: Make sure to turn off the power to your oven before servicing it.

In this post

How do I fix my oven that won’t heat?

  1. Check the position of the oven and stove knobs.
  2. Use an oven thermometer to determine the temperature difference.
  3. Consider replacing an electric oven’s heating element.
  4. Clean the igniter on a gas stove.
  5. Check the temperature sensor.
  6. Consult the owner’s manual if a digital oven is displaying error codes.

Is there a reset button on an electric oven?

Turn the circuit breaker to the OFF position or remove the fuse. Wait one minute, then turn the circuit breaker back to the ON position or install the fuse to reset power to the unit. This should reset the electronic controls on the range or wall oven.

How much does it cost to replace a heating element in an oven?

Cost of Oven Heating Element
Heating elements typically cost only $20 to $25. With labor, you can expect to pay around $220 to replace your old element.

How do I know if my oven element is blown?

The most common problem with oven elements is when the oven light and fan come on but the oven element won’t heat up at all. This is the classic sign that the element needs replacing.

Is it worth fixing an oven?

If the repair cost is low, you will likely be better off paying for the repair even if your oven is older than 20 years. If your oven needs a $1,000 repair and it’s over 15 years old, you’re likely better off replacing the oven if replacement cost is less than $2,000.

How long should an electric oven last?

about 13-15 years
Average lifespan: about 13-15 years
While gas ranges tend to last an average of 15 years, electric ones average about 13. To maintain your stove and oven, be sure to clean them regularly.

How do I know if my thermal fuse is blown?

To test if your thermal fuse has blown, touch the right side of your multimeter lead to the right side of the fuse, and repeat with the left multimeter lead. If the multimeter needle fails to move, this indicates the thermal fuse has blown.

How do you reset a Frigidaire electric oven?

But the first thing you should do is try to perform a hard reset by unplugging the oven, waiting about 30 seconds, and then plugging it back in again. In some cases, this will be enough to reset the control board and get your oven working again.

How much does it cost to replace an oven?

Written by HomeAdvisor. The cost to install a new oven runs between $350 and $15,000. Most homeowners spend about $2,000 on average for the unit and installation. Factors that impact the total price for installing a new oven include the oven type, its energy source, location in the home, and necessary preparations.
